My wife had a consumer proposal. She could not continue paying it. Her consumer proposal was cancelled. The big problem is that the trustee originally marked her monthly income way too high when obviously she did not have any income. What can be done in this situation because she does not want the creditors to come after her?

If the consumer proposal did not work you will likely have to consider filing for bankruptcy if you want to continue to benefit from the creditor protection.
